Lead Software Engineer - Studio Tech
Locations:
Los Angeles, Los Angeles, United States
Type:
Contract
Published:
May 12, 2025
Contact:
Ian Kanewski
Ref:
16322
Required Skills:
Kotlin,Java
Share this job
Apply

Lead Software Engineer – Studio Tech

Onsite in Glendale - Initial 7 month contract open to extend and/or convert to FTE

We’re working with a leading global media and entertainment company to help grow their internal Studio Technology team. They’re hiring a Lead Software Engineer to join the group responsible for building a secure, high-performance screening platform used to deliver pre-release content to internal stakeholders. This is a high-impact role on a platform that protects proprietary IP and ensures high-quality media delivery across the organization.

If you’re passionate about streaming technologies, backend engineering, and contributing to a growing team focused on building robust internal tools, this could be a great fit.


Responsibilities

  • Build scalable, production-grade services in a collaborative, agile environment.

  • Work with modern technologies such as Java, Kotlin, Spring Boot, Docker, Kubernetes, Elasticsearch, and others.

  • Develop and integrate solutions using AWS technologies like EKS, S3, Cognito.

  • Contribute to technical strategy and architecture for complex software systems.

  • Lead architectural discussions, provide mentorship, and drive best practices.

  • Participate in peer code reviews and provide constructive feedback.

  • Troubleshoot and resolve production issues; participate in operational support when needed.

  • Mentor and support other engineers on the team.


Basic Qualifications

  • Bachelor’s degree in Computer Science or related field (or equivalent work experience).

  • 7+ years of experience designing backend systems and shipping production-level code.

  • Proficient in functional programming and building RESTful APIs.

  • Deep understanding of Object-Oriented Design (OOD) and software architecture.

  • 5+ years of experience with Java, Kotlin, or similar object-oriented languages.

  • 3+ years working with Node.js.

  • Experience working in Agile/Scrum environments.

  • 5+ years working with both relational and NoSQL databases (e.g., PostgreSQL, MySQL, DynamoDB).


Preferred Qualifications

  • Strong familiarity with Git, source control workflows, and CI/CD pipelines.

  • Hands-on experience with observability and monitoring tools (e.g., Datadog, Splunk, Conviva).

  • Exposure to video players and streaming technologies (e.g., HLS, DRM, watermarking).

  • Understanding of video content distribution workflows.

  • Advanced experience with AWS architecture and services (e.g., S3, Lambda, Cognito).

  • Ability to digest and implement technical standards and complex specifications.

Apply